Recommended workflow

Start with the public pages an AI assistant should use, then link exact public data downloads where rows matter. Keep the file readable and maintain it as the site graph changes.

  • List product, tool, comparison, asset, and answer pages.
  • Add concise summaries for source-heavy pages.
  • Link JSON and CSV downloads for public datasets.
  • Describe what the product does and does not guarantee.
  • Update the template whenever new sourceable pages are added.
